Link gekopieerd
Hoi mensen,
Ik heb nu index.php als volgt;
<?php $_SERVER["HTTP_REFERER"];
print_r($_SERVER)
?>
en krijg nu als echo;
Array ( [DOCUMENT_ROOT] => /www/htdocs/colorsto/ [HTTP_ACCEPT] => */* [HTTP_ACCEPT_ENCODING] => gzip, deflate [HTTP_ACCEPT_LANGUAGE] => nl [HTTP_CONNECTION] => Keep-Alive [HTTP_HOST] =>
www.colorstone.eu [HTTP_UA_CPU] => x86 [HTTP_USER_AGENT] =>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; .NET CLR 1.1.4322; .NET CLR 2.0.50727) [PATH] => /sbin:/usr/sbin:/usr/local/sbin:/opt/gnome/sbin:/root/bin:/usr/local/bin:/usr/bin:/usr/X11R6/bin:/bin:/usr/games:/opt/gnome/bin:/usr/lib/mit/bin:/usr/lib/mit/sbin [REDIRECT_QUERY_STRING] => referer=http://
www.croesecommunicatie.com/test.htm [REDIRECT_STATUS] => 200 [REDIRECT_URL] => /test/ [REMOTE_ADDR] => 77.160.13.213 [REMOTE_HOST] => ip4da00dd5.direct-adsl.nl [REMOTE_PORT] => 1419 [SCRIPT_FILENAME] => /www/htdocs/colorsto/test/index.php [SERVER_ADDR] => 195.20.9.44 [SERVER_ADMIN] =>
[email protected] [SERVER_NAME] =>
www.colorstone.eu [SERVER_PORT] => 80 [SERVER_SIGNATURE] =>
Apache/1.3.34 Server at
www.colorstone.eu Port 80
[SERVER_SOFTWARE] => Apache/1.3.34 (Unix) FrontPage/5.0.2.2635 PHP/5.2.0 mod_ssl/2.8.25 OpenSSL/0.9.8a [GATEWAY_INTERFACE] => CGI/1.1 [SERVER_PROTOCOL] => HTTP/1.1 [REQUEST_METHOD] => GET [QUERY_STRING] => referer=http://
www.croesecommunicatie.com/test.htm [REQUEST_URI] => /test/?referer=http://
www.croesecommunicatie.com/test.htm [SCRIPT_NAME] => /test/index.php [PATH_TRANSLATED] => /www/htdocs/colorsto/test/index.php [PHP_SELF] => /test/index.php [REQUEST_TIME] => 1194520633 [argv] => Array ( [0] => referer=http://
www.croesecommunicatie.com/test.htm ) [argc] => 1 )
Komt iemand hier wijs uit?
Link gekopieerd
Als ik het zo doe;
<?php echo "$_SERVER['HTTP_REFERER']"; ?>
dan krijg ik als echo 'Array ['HTTP_REFERER']'
Link gekopieerd
Marco, stoppen met bumpen! Als je iets aan je vorige post toe te voegen hebt kun je de edit knop gebruiken...
Als je een klein momentje geduld hebt, zal ik wel even een klein voorbeeldje voor je maken.
Zie
hier .
Link gekopieerd
Ik heb index.php nu zo;
<?php
session_start();
$_SESSION['referer'] = $_GET['referer'];
echo 'Je komt van '.$_SESSION['referer'];
?>
en hij doet het. Bedankt voor het meedenken!!
Sorry, Blanche, voor het bumpen.
Link gekopieerd
Oh wacht, het gaat om een popup. Dan zou je dat ook met puur Javascript op kunnen lossen. Het window.opener element bevat namelijk alle gegevens over de pagina waardoor de popup geopend is.
Zie dit
voorbeeld .
Link gekopieerd